Newbie here. I love every song on MIH. The very most beautiful song on the album, and that I have heard in my lifetime of listening is A Winter's Tale. Written composed and keyboarded by Freddie, it has a much different, surreal sound and feel. I hear more appreciative beauty than sadness and self blame, putting himself down as in Mother Love (also painfully beautiful). AWT is so psychedelic it leads me to believe Freddie felt his morphine while writing it. Nevertheless the song exudes positivity, hope, and inner peace. I give AWT a 10+++.[/QUOTE]

Simply put, "Made in Heaven" is a gem!
By this time -1995- there was no way i thought that Queen would release an album that could top "Sheer heart attack" or "Innuendo" on my personal list of the albums i most enjoyed listen to.
I wasn´t prepared for the experience. And it was an experience that i have never achieved before or after that album. I remember going to a store on the day of release and just out of curiosity i put the headphones on and started to listen to bits of it. I imediatelly stoped because i knew what was coming. It was brilliance and i wanted to save the best for when i get home alone.
I listen to the album and i actually cried! When "Mother Love" came in my headphones, i just broke. When i heard "I Was Born to love you" my admiration for Brian just increased - if that was even possible - and by the end of the album i was speechless.
I wasn´t expecting something as brilliant as this. A work of genius!
There was a review at the time that said that MIH was probably the most beautifull album in rock.
I have to agree with this. Beautifull!
The way they presented each track was just outstanding, and Brian was superb during them all and so was Roger and John.
I was proud of the boys, and still am!
